Heim > Web-Frontend > HTML-Tutorial > 急!IE7、IE8下td中的img不显示。_html/css_WEB-ITnose

急!IE7、IE8下td中的img不显示。_html/css_WEB-ITnose

WBOY
Freigeben: 2016-06-24 12:24:04
Original
1558 Leute haben es durchsucht

html ie7 ie8

 <td>                            <ul class="inline">                                <li>                                    <img src="../img/A1201001.jpg"   style="max-width:90%" class="img_size" alt=""/>                                </li>                                <li>1235</li>                            </ul>                        </td>
Nach dem Login kopieren


把img直接放在td中是可以显示的,现在我的需求是可能有多个图片需要在一个td中显示,如果都直接放在td中,tr的高度太大了,所以我需要img在td中排列成一排显示。
上面的td是在table中的一个单元格,但是img放在li中后,在IE7和IE8下不显示,文本1235可以显示。我把ul替换成table,img也是一样的不显示,但是table显示了。
这是什么问题啊?求大神指点?


回复讨论(解决方案)

LZ可以改为DIV+IMG的方式,显示在一排上

非常感谢!

我的解决方法

for (var i = 0; i < urlArr.length; i++) {                        imgs += "<img src=\"" + urlArr[i] + "\" class=\"img_size\" alt=\"\" />";                    }                    if (imgs != "") {                        imgs = "<div class='row-fluid'>" + imgs + "</div>";                        $(this).children("td:last").width(urlArr.length * 22).append(imgs);                    }
Nach dem Login kopieren
Quelle:php.cn
Erklärung dieser Website
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n
Beliebte Tutorials
Mehr>
Neueste Downloads
Mehr>
Web-Effekte
Quellcode der Website
Website-Materialien
Frontend-Vorlage